Season 4 Episode 3: Escobar's Castle

Watch Mysteries of the Abandoned season 4 episode 3 tv series online free
Release: Apr 18, 2019

The ruins of a once-palatial compound contain the secrets of one of history's most notorious criminals, and new discoveries reveal why this high-security estate was built and why it was abandoned.

Mysteries of the Abandonedexpand_lessSeason 4